So Powerful Artificial Intelligence has been divided into four categories. So now let me explain to you one by one:

Reactive machine:
A good example of this Reactive Blue machine. And is usually applied in the Chess Board. It can identify the pieces of a chessboard and make predictions. But the drawback is that it has no memory. That is, it cannot use past experience to predict the future. So only use the current situation and just moving a pawn. It is intended for the application of a small situation. the situation can be handled in the moment itself.

Limited Memory:
Type AI applied where there is a need for memory. Some engines work on the basis of past experience. This means they are the information about the same thing that happened in the past and do the appropriate job this time. Type the majority of AI used in the field of self-driving cars. Using memory to act in situations such as traffic collisions.

Theory of mind:
Type AI refers to the understanding of the other's behavior and does the work in accordance with these include feelings. intentions, moving from others. In general, the type of AI is still not there. And today most scientists ware working hard to get practical.

Self-awareness:
As of the above types, types of Artificial Intelligence systems, need to bring practical. They think that this system should be self-aware and should have the ability to understand other people's feelings
Why is artificial intelligence important?
AI automates repetitive learning and discovery through data. But AI is different from the hardware-driven, robotic automation. Instead of automating manual tasks, AI Perform frequent, high-volume, computerized tasks reliably and without fatigue. For this type of automation, human inquiry is still important to regulate the system and asking the right questions.

AI adds intelligence to existing products. In most cases, the AI ​​will not be sold as an individual application. Instead, you are already using the product will be enhanced by the ability of AI, such as Siri was added as a feature to a new generation of Apple products. Automation, platform conversation, bots, and intelligent machines can be combined with large amounts of data to improve a lot of technology in the home and in the workplace, from the security intelligence for investment analysis.

AI adapts through progressive learning algorithms to let the data do the programming. AI found the structure and regularity in the data so that the algorithm acquired skills: be a classifier algorithm or predictor. So, as the algorithm can teach himself how to play chess, he can teach themselves what to recommend further products online. And adaptable models when given new data. Backpropagation is AI techniques that allow the model to adjust, through training and data added when the first answer is incorrect.
AI analyzes the data more and more in using neural networks which have a lot of hidden layers. Building a fraud detection system with five hidden layers nearly impossible a few years ago. All that has changed with exceptional computing power and big data. You need a lot of data to train the learning model because they learn directly from the data. The more data that can feed them, the more accurate they become.
AI achieve exceptional accuracy through deep neural networks - that were previously impossible. For example, your interactions with Alexa, Google Search, and Google Photos are all based on in-depth learning - and they keep getting more accurate the more you use it. In the medical field, the AI ​​technique of learning in, image classification and object recognition can now be used to find cancer on MRI with the same accuracy as highly trained radiologists.
AI gets the most out of data. When the self-learning algorithms, the data itself can be intellectual property. The answer is in the data; You just have to apply AI to get them out. Because the data is now a more important role than ever before, it can create a competitive advantage. If you have the best data in a competitive industry, even if everyone applying similar techniques, the best data will win.

Blockchain technology provides a way for the parties which are not believed to come to an agreement about the state of the database, without using an intermediary. By providing books that manage nothing, blockchain can provide certain financial services - such as payment, or securitization - without the use of intermediaries, such as banks.
Furthermore, blockchain allows for the use of tools such as "smart contract," which potentially automating manual processes, from compliance and claims processing, to distribute the contents of a will.
For a use case that does not need a high degree of decentralization - but could benefit from better coordination - cousin blockchain this, "distributed technology ledger (DLT)," can help corporations build governance and standards around data sharing and better collaboration.
With the global banking industry is currently $ 134T, blockchain and DLT technology could disintermediate key services that the bank provides, including:
Payment: By building a decentralized books for payment (eg Bitcoin), blockchain technology could facilitate faster payments at a lower cost than banks.
Clearance and Settlement Systems: Distributed ledger can reduce operational costs and bring us closer to the real-time transactions between financial institutions.
Fundraising: Coin Initial Offer (ICOS) is experimenting with a new model of financing that unbundles access to capital from traditional capital-raising services and companies.
Effect: With tokenizing traditional securities such as stocks, bonds, and alternative assets - and put them in public blockchains - blockchain technology could make the capital market more efficient interoperable.
Loans and Credits: By removing the need for gatekeepers in loans and credit industry, blockchain technology can make it safer to borrow money and give you a lower interest rate.
Trade Finance: By replacing the complicated bill, paper-heavy process of lading in the trade finance industry, blockchain technology can create more transparency, security, and trust between the parties of global trade.

Applications of Artificial Intelligence in Internet of Things
While both of these disciplines have individual value, their true potential can only be realized together. There are a lot of different applications in several industries that require Artificial Intelligence and the Internet of Things. Some of this is as follows:
1. Collaborative Robot
Ever wanted to help the robot? Well, that's what you'll get with Collaborative Robots or Cobots. Cobots is a very complex machine that is designed to help people in shared workspace environments ranging from the office to the industry. They can be a robotic arm designed to perform tasks or even complex robots designed to fulfill the tasks difficult.
2. Drones
Drone aircraft is without a human pilot (piloting is done by the software!). They are very useful because they can navigate unknown environments (even those outside the reach of the internet) and the area reaches dangerous to humans such as offshore operations, mining, war zone or burning buildings.
3. Smart City
When everything is getting smarter, why not the whole city? smart cities can be made with a sensor network attached to the physical infrastructure of the city. This sensor can be used to monitor the city's various civil factors such as energy efficiency, air pollution, water use, noise pollution, traffic conditions, etc.
4. Digital Twins
Digital Twins twins (obviously!) The object in which the real-world objects and the other is the digital replica. These objects can range from aircraft engines to wind turbines. Digital Twins mainly used to analyze the performance of an object without using traditional testing methods and reduce the cost required for testing.
5. Smart Retailing
It created a smart shopping! AI and IOT can be used by retailers to understand customer behavior (by studying the profiles of consumers online, in-store inventory, etc.).

Artificial Intelligence Vs Robotics
Defining Robotics and AI
Robotics is the branch of science that deals with the development of robots. Robot aims to complete the work done by humans in much lower with better efficiency. The robot can automatically or need some initial guidance from humans.
AI is a branch of computer science and assists in developing software that can perform tasks that need personal discretion, decision-making, and intelligence as these qualities may not otherwise be programmed into a computer. AI development service can help the machine learn and understand the environment to adapt according to the situation. AI can even solve different problems, cope with logical reasoning and also to learn the language.
Robots are programmed and interact with their surroundings using sensors. They may be automatic or semi-automatic depending on the area of ​​their application.
AI is a science that depends on machine learning and algorithms. If described in words is limited, AI is working on its own decision making and reasoning.
